  • Record-breaking Tendulkar puts Proteas to the swords

    February 24, 2010

    INDIA’S Sachin Tendulkar etched his name in the cricket record books once again after becoming the first batsman ever in the 39 years of one-day cricket to score a double century. The Little Master smashed 25 fours and three sixes in a stunning unbeaten 200 off 147 balls as India completed a 153-run thrashing of [...]

  • Construction group Kier sees first half profits rise by 21pc

    February 24, 2010

    CONSTRUCTION group Kier has posted strong results for the first half of its financial year seeing a 21 per cent rise in profits. Profits before tax went up to £31.9m from £26.4m, while the company’s net cash for the half year reached £130.7m compared to 2008 when it was at £82.2m. Chief executive John Dodds [...]

  • Galliford Try shares gain following strong results

    February 24, 2010

    Shares in Galliford Try yesterday gained 1.1 per cent, after the construction and housebuilding firm posted strong first-half results. Galliford reports a pre-tax profit, after exceptional items, of £6.4m in the six months to end December, compared with a loss of £37.5m in the same period in 2008.
